Confabulate is a word that generally refers to informal communication. This can range from casual conversation to more formal discussions. Some synonyms for confabulate include chat, converse, talk, discuss, and confer. Each of these words can be used to describe different types of communication. Chatting is often seen as more casual, while conferencing is usually a more formal setting. Conversing can be either formal or informal, depending on the context. Talking is often used to describe a presentation or lecture-style communication, while discussing implies a more in-depth exploration of a topic. Ultimately, the choice of synonym will depend on the tone and purpose of the communication.
